The tense relationship between the clay court specialist Casper Ruud and bad boy Nick Kyrgios probably began in 2019. There the Australian made one of the most notable freaks in his career so far, destroyed a chair and finally said goodbye to the shower early on. Ruud, on the other hand, was able to be happy about entering the next round after Kyrgios' disqualification.
Of course, that wasn't the end of it, a few weeks later Ruud came back to the game - and justified his jubilation despite the less than glorious end to various media portals: "That I celebrated my victory? I didn't care. I was glad Having won 90 points and $50,000 in prize money, so why shouldn't I celebrate? It's his problem that he's an idiot on the court," Ruud said at the time.
Kyrgios didn't like this statement to some extent - and sent a message via social media: "The next time you have something to say, I would appreciate it if you said it to my face, I'm sure you wouldn't be like that afterwards talk a lot. Until then I'd rather watch the paint dry than watch you play tennis," the Australian wrote on Twitter.
There was also a brief quarrel between the two last year, when Kyrgios answered the Norwegian's question about what his favorite clay court tournament was, with "your mother". Deleted this underhand but quite quickly. However, this should not have been a balm for the already battered relationship between the two. So now there is a reunion on the court: Kyrgios, in Indian Wells so far in an excellent mood to play, challenges the current number eight in the tennis world, Casper Ruud.
